HS Code for Patterned Steel <4.75 mm

Introduction to Patterned Steel and HS Codes

In the world of international trade and logistics, understanding the correct classification of products is crucial for smooth customs clearance and accurate tariff application. Patterned steel, particularly thin patterned steel with a thickness of less than 4.75 mm, is a specialized product used in various industries for both functional and aesthetic purposes. This article will delve into the HS (Harmonized System) code for this specific type of steel, its applications, and the importance of proper classification in global trade.

What is Patterned Steel?

Patterned steel, also known as decorative sheet or textured finish steel, is a type of steel product that has been processed to have a specific surface pattern or texture. This can be achieved through various methods, including:

  • Embossing
  • Etching
  • Rolling with patterned rollers
  • Laser engraving

These processes create a unique surface appearance that can enhance both the aesthetic appeal and functional properties of the steel. Patterned steel with a thickness of less than 4.75 mm is particularly versatile and finds applications in numerous industries.

HS Code Classification for Patterned Steel <4.75 mm

The Harmonized System (HS) is an international nomenclature developed by the World Customs Organization (WCO) for the classification of goods. It forms the basis for customs tariffs and international trade statistics. For patterned steel with a thickness of less than 4.75 mm, the HS code classification typically falls under Chapter 72 of the HS, which covers "Iron and Steel."

The specific HS code for patterned steel <4.75 mm is:

7208.39 - Flat-rolled products of iron or non-alloy steel, of a width of 600 mm or more, hot-rolled, not clad, plated or coated, other, of a thickness of less than 3 mm

or

7208.40 - Flat-rolled products of iron or non-alloy steel, of a width of 600 mm or more, hot-rolled, not clad, plated or coated, not in coils, with patterns in relief

The exact code may vary depending on the specific composition, manufacturing process, and intended use of the patterned steel. It's essential to consult with customs experts or use official resources to determine the most accurate classification for your specific product.

Applications of Thin Patterned Steel

Thin patterned steel with a thickness of less than 4.75 mm has a wide range of applications across various industries. Some common uses include:

  1. Architecture and Construction: Used for decorative wall panels, ceiling tiles, and façade elements.
  2. Automotive Industry: Applied in interior trim components and exterior body panels for texture and visual appeal.
  3. Appliance Manufacturing: Utilized in refrigerators, washing machines, and other home appliances for both functional and aesthetic purposes.
  4. Furniture Design: Incorporated into modern furniture pieces for unique textures and visual interest.
  5. Industrial Equipment: Used in machinery housings and control panels for improved grip and wear resistance.

Importance of Correct HS Code Classification

Accurate classification of patterned steel using the correct HS code is crucial for several reasons:

  • Customs Compliance: Proper classification ensures compliance with customs regulations and avoids penalties or delays in shipment.
  • Tariff Determination: The HS code directly affects the tariff rates applied to the imported or exported goods.
  • Trade Statistics: Accurate classification contributes to reliable international trade statistics, which are used for economic analysis and policy-making.
  • Trade Agreements: Certain trade agreements may offer preferential treatment based on the HS code of the product.

Challenges in Classifying Patterned Steel

While the HS code system provides a standardized framework for classification, there can be challenges in determining the correct code for specialized products like patterned steel. Some common difficulties include:

  1. Variations in Manufacturing Processes: Different production methods may affect the classification.
  2. Multiple Applicable Categories: Some products may potentially fit into more than one HS code category.
  3. Evolving Technologies: New manufacturing techniques may not be explicitly covered in existing HS codes.
  4. Country-Specific Interpretations: Different countries may have varying interpretations of HS codes for certain products.

Trade Considerations for Patterned Steel

When engaging in international trade of patterned steel products, there are several factors to consider:

  • Quality Standards: Ensure that the patterned steel meets the quality standards and specifications required in the destination country.
  • Packaging: Proper packaging is crucial to protect the decorative surface of the steel during transportation.
  • Trade Regulations: Be aware of any trade restrictions or additional requirements for steel products in your target markets.
  • Certifications: Some countries may require specific certifications for steel products, particularly for use in construction or automotive applications.

Future Trends in Patterned Steel Trade

The market for patterned steel, especially thin sheets with decorative finishes, is evolving. Some trends to watch include:

  1. Sustainable Production: Increasing focus on environmentally friendly manufacturing processes for patterned steel.
  2. Advanced Textures: Development of new patterns and textures to meet evolving design trends in architecture and product design.
  3. Lightweight Solutions: Growing demand for thinner, lighter patterned steel for use in automotive and aerospace industries.
  4. Digital Customization: Adoption of digital technologies to create customized patterns and finishes on steel sheets.
